Definitions:

Behavioral Activation

A therapeutic approach focusing on engaging individuals in activities that promote positive emotional experiences as a means to combat depression.

Operant Conditioning

A method of learning that occurs through rewards and punishments for behavior, encouraging the subject to associate behaviors with their consequences.

Classical Conditioning

A learning process that occurs through associations between an environmental stimulus and a naturally occurring stimulus.

Little Albert

An experiment conducted by John B. Watson and Rosalie Rayner which demonstrated classical conditioning in humans, specifically showing how fear can be conditioned.
